zig development
This commit is contained in:
parent
c2f8b07b71
commit
448372de7a
2 changed files with 6 additions and 1 deletions
|
@ -17,7 +17,8 @@ in {
|
||||||
devenv.enable = enableOption "devenv" true;
|
devenv.enable = enableOption "devenv" true;
|
||||||
lang = {
|
lang = {
|
||||||
c.enable = enableOption "clangd" false;
|
c.enable = enableOption "clangd" false;
|
||||||
csharp.enable = enableOption "sharp" false;
|
csharp.enable = enableOption "csharp" false;
|
||||||
|
zig.enable = enableOption "zig" false;
|
||||||
};
|
};
|
||||||
};
|
};
|
||||||
|
|
||||||
|
@ -69,6 +70,9 @@ in {
|
||||||
omnisharp-roslyn
|
omnisharp-roslyn
|
||||||
];
|
];
|
||||||
})
|
})
|
||||||
|
(lib.mkIf cfg.lang.zig.enable {
|
||||||
|
home.packages = with pkgs; [zig zls];
|
||||||
|
})
|
||||||
(lib.mkIf cfg.docs.enable {
|
(lib.mkIf cfg.docs.enable {
|
||||||
programs.man.generateCaches = true;
|
programs.man.generateCaches = true;
|
||||||
})
|
})
|
||||||
|
|
|
@ -89,6 +89,7 @@
|
||||||
lang = {
|
lang = {
|
||||||
c = enabled;
|
c = enabled;
|
||||||
csharp = enabled;
|
csharp = enabled;
|
||||||
|
zig = enabled;
|
||||||
};
|
};
|
||||||
};
|
};
|
||||||
gaming = {
|
gaming = {
|
||||||
|
|
Loading…
Add table
Add a link
Reference in a new issue